In a significant political reshuffle, Governor Douye Diri of Bayelsa State has appointed Dr. Peter Akpe as his new deputy following the untimely death of his predecessor. This decision comes amid intense scrutiny and pressure, as Diri emphasized the importance of selecting a candidate who embodies both capability and integrity.

Diri reflected on the difficult process, stating, “I faced immense pressure to choose someone who could not only fill the role but also unite our party and the people.” Akpe, a well-respected figure known for his dedication to public service, was chosen after careful consideration of various potential candidates. His appointment is seen as a strategic move to bolster governance and enhance the administration’s effectiveness at a crucial time.
